Cell Phone Service Restored

In North Otsego After 3 Days

RICHFIELD SPRINGS – A Verizon spokesman reported a few minutes ago that cell-phone service has been restored in the Richfield Springs area.

Residents report being without cellphone connections since Friday evening.
